Dawn Walker Chapter 81

--- "Okay," it said, struggling like a child promised candy later. "But... later." Sekhmet did not answer. He focused inward. "The mission says to consume twenty different types. I have eleven. I need nine more." He activated Blood Eye and scanned the jars quickly, searching for distinct types. He did not need to drink a whole jar. A sip would count. A taste. Just enough for the system to register. He selected nine jars with different classifications. Beastkin (Boar) blood. Night Deer blood. Sky Serpent blood. Shadow Lizard blood. Demonkin blood. Beast King blood flakes. Fallen Angel blood. Unknown humanoid beast blood. One more jar that smelled strange, labeled by blood eye as "Ash Fang Raptor," a beast from some distant part of purgatory that had been preserved well. "Nine. That made twenty." Sekhmet stared at them. His throat tightened. This was not a heroic moment. This was not a proud moment. This was a man preparing to drink blood like medicine. He sat down slowly on the chair by the table. His hand hovered over the first jar. Bat Bat watched him, silent. Sekhmet’s fingers touched the jar. He felt the cold glass. He felt the weight of what he was becoming. "I used to drink water," He opened the first jar. Pop! A faint scent rose. Boar blood. It was Earthy. It was heavy. Sekhmet lifted it. He hesitated. Then he took a sip. It hit his tongue thickly, metallic, warm even though it was preserved. His throat tightened instinctively as if his body wanted to reject it. Then his blood awakened. A subtle shift inside him, like a locked door opening slightly. The taste became... tolerable. Not pleasant. Not disgusting either. Just fuel for his body. Sekhmet swallowed. He set the jar down. "One." He opened the next. Night Deer blood. The scent was lighter, almost sweet, with a faint warmth of stamina. He took a sip. This one felt smoother going down. It did not burn. It settled in his stomach and turned into a gentle heat in his limbs. "Two." Then... Sky Serpent blood. It smelled sharp, like lightning trapped in a jar. Sekhmet took a sip. This one made his tongue tingle. His eyes watered slightly. The blood carried a faint light affinity trace, causing a brief bright sensation behind his eyes, like someone had flashed a torch inside his skull. He grimaced. Bat Bat giggled. Sekhmet glared at it. Bat Bat pretended to be innocent. "Three done." Shadow Lizard blood. It was cool. It was dark in colour. Sekhmet took a sip. This one slid down like cold oil. For a heartbeat, his shadow on the wall seemed to deepen, then return to normal. "Four." He moved through the jars one by one. Some were simple. Some were strange. Demonkin blood was thick and violent. It tasted like anger. It made his heartbeat quicken for a few seconds, his muscles tightening as if ready to fight. Beast King blood flakes had to be dissolved with a little chaos energy. When he tasted it, it carried an ancient bitterness, a dominance that made his jaw clench. Fallen Angel (a fantasy race) blood tasted like metal and ash and something sorrowful. It left a faint sting in his chest, like a memory that didn’t belong to him. Unknown humanoid beast blood was... disturbing. It tasted almost like normal human blood, but with an extra cold depth behind it. His instincts whispered that it belonged to something that looked human but wasn’t. Ash Fang Raptor blood tasted sharp and predatory. It made his senses sharpen briefly, hearing the house creak somewhere far away, smelling the wood, smelling Bat Bat’s faint sweet scent. One more sip. Nine more acknowledgments of what he was becoming. By the time he finished, he sat still for a moment, breathing slowly. His stomach felt heavy. His mind felt sharper. His throat felt less dry. Bat Bat stared at him with growing outrage. "You drink," Bat Bat said slowly. "You drink it all." Sekhmet wiped his mouth calmly. "I tasted them for you," he corrected. Bat Bat’s wings flared. "Tasted drink without giving it to me," it accused. Sekhmet’s voice remained flat. "I am preparing," he said. Bat Bat narrowed its eyes. "Preparing... without sharing," it muttered. Sekhmet glanced at it. "Later," he repeated firmly. Bat Bat slumped dramatically on the bed, like it was dying from betrayal. Sekhmet ignored it and focused inward again. The system chimed instantly, like it had been waiting. [Ding! First Mission is Complete: Blood Variety Trial. 20/20 blood types consumed. Reward Granted: +40% Blood Proficiency. Blood Proficiency: 100.0% Blood Awakening: +1% Current Blood Awakening: 3%] Sekhmet’s breath caught. His body reacted before his mind could. Heat surged through his veins, not chaotic and wild like the blood god takeover, but controlled, organized, like power being poured into channels that had been carved already. His heartbeat deepened. Ba - dum... Ba - dum... Not slow like before. Strong. His senses sharpened again. His eyes seemed to see the lantern flame in more detail, the tiny movements of air around it, the faint dust particles drifting. Then the system spoke again. [Ding! The host qualifies for a skill upgrade. Select one skill to upgrade.] Sekhmet did not hesitate. The system itself had advised him. Blood Summon needed to be upgraded before he used summoned skill. He wanted the harpy bat to be as strong as possible. He chose. "Upgrade Blood Summon." The system responded immediately. [Ding! Upgrading Blood Summon... Processing... ... .... ... ... Upgrade Complete.] A cold rush passed through Sekhmet’s head. For a moment, he felt as if his mind had expanded — like he could sense a larger space around him, a wider network, more "slots" in reality where summons could exist. Then the system’s notification appeared. [Ding! Skill Upgrade Confirmed. Blood Summon Lv2 acquired.] A new wave of power followed. [Blood Summon Lv2 Effects: – Minimum summon battle power increased. 1000 battle power is the lowest summon. – Summon stability improved. – Low-grade blood now produces higher baseline minions. – Rare blood summons can evolve into Harpies. – Summon formation speed increased. – All summons gained the upgrade skill of Claw and bite.] Then more notifications came. [Ding! Stat Increase Detected. Chaos Energy: +500 Chaos Body: +500] Sekhmet’s eyes widened slightly. He pulled up his status window instinctively.
